Pune: Union Home Minister Amit Shah is set to visit Pune on February 22 to chair the Western Zonal Meeting of the Union Home Department. The meeting, which will be held at a five-star hotel in Koregaon Park, will be attended by senior officials from Maharashtra, Gujarat, Goa, Dadra and Nagar Haveli, and Daman & Diu.

Preparations Underway for High-Level Meeting

The district administration has started preparations for the high-profile event. Pune Municipal Corporation Additional Commissioner Prithviraj B.P. has been appointed as the nodal officer to oversee arrangements, while 11 other officials have been given specific responsibilities to ensure the smooth conduct of the meeting.

Uncertainty Over Shah’s Political Engagements in Pune

This visit marks Amit Shah’s first trip to Pune after the Assembly elections. Given the occasion, local BJP leaders are making efforts to arrange a political event featuring his presence. However, no official confirmation has been received regarding his participation in any such programs.

As the date approaches, further details about Amit Shah’s schedule in Pune are expected to be finalized.
